Moisturize, Moisturize, Moisturize:
Again, keeping your skin moisturized will alleviate the itching
associated with eczema. Find the thickest, creamiest moisturizer you
can find and lather it on. Vaseline works well. Apply as often as
needed. Make sure to apply moisturize after each shower or bath. The
water remains on your skin would help to lock in the moisturizer.
Use an Emollient:
Emollients work well in treating Eczema. You can find emollients in the
form of cream, lotion, or oil. It helps to smooth, moisten and protect
the skin.
Oatmeal bath:
Oatmeal baths are great natural treatment for eczema, which is also
very relaxing. Aveeno makes a Colloidal oatmeal baths or you can try to
make one on your own. Simply add 1-2 cups of oatmeal to your warm bath
water. After the oatmeal bath, moisturize your damp skin with extra
rich moisturizer.

Flaxseed Oil: Flaxseed oil can help to reduce inflammation. One tablespoon of flaxseed oil a day can help to reduce eczema inflammation.
Primrose Oil:
Primrose Oil can help to reduce the discomfort of eczema. Take about 2
grams of primrose oil a day with food is sufficient. It might take some
time before you feel the result. You can also apply Evening Primrose
Oil directly on the affected area. It will help to relieve the
discomfort.
Vitamin E:
Lather the eczema affected areas with Vitamin E cream or oil, and take
a Vitamin E supplement will help healing the damaged skin and relieve
the itching.
